Leedey, OK vs West Siloam Springs, OK
Leedey is moderately more affordable than West Siloam Springs, with a 13.2% lower cost of living index. Leedey scores 64 compared to 74 for West Siloam Springs, where the US average is 100. This difference means residents of West Siloam Springs can expect to pay noticeably more for everyday expenses, housing, and services.
On the housing front, median rent in Leedey is $808/month compared to $939/month in West Siloam Springs — a 14%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: Leedey is more affordable at $104,500 median vs $175,400.
Median household income in Leedey is $72,500 compared to $59,438 in West Siloam Springs (+22%). Leedey offers a double advantage: higher earnings combined with a lower cost of living, giving residents significantly more purchasing power. Looking at affordability, residents of Leedey spend roughly 13.4% of their income on rent, less than the 19% in West Siloam Springs.
